Question 795257: An airplane makes a trip in 4.3 hours flying with a headwind. The plane makes the trip back in 3.9 hours with a tailwind. If the windspeed is 10 miles per hour find the speed of the airplane. Answer by Cromlix(4381) (Show Source):

Airplane flying with headwind = x - 10
Airplane flying with tailwind = x + 10
4.3 * (x - 10) = 3.9 * (x + 10)
4.3x - 43 = 3.9x + 39
Collect like terms:
4.3x - 3.9x = 39 + 43
0.4x = 82
x = 205 mph
This is the airplane's speed.
